Woman Tries To Repeatedly Buy iPads With Food Stamp Card

 Tracy Browning, a 38-year-old Louisville woman, was jailed after she allegedly tried to purchase several iPads with a food stamp card, then fled to another location where she tried to make the same transaction.

According to Louisville police, Browning went to the Valley Station Walmart and tried to purchase two iPads with an Electronic Benefit Transfer card. When the transaction was denied, she assaulted a store clerk, pushed another employee to the ground and fled from the store with the merchandise.

Investigators say Browning went to another Walmart in the area a short time later and again attempted to buy several iPads with an EBT card. She was apprehended at the scene while attempting to flee with the merchandise.

Browning, according to police, has been banned from all Wal-Mart locations due to prior incidents with the store.

She was booked into the Louisville Metro Jail and charged with robbery, shoplifting and trespassing.
